<p style="text-align: justify;">The novelty is built on a Qualcomm MSM 7200A CPU platform at a frequency of 528 MHz. Nowadays this is one of the most powerful processors, which is convenient to work with absolutely any application. RAM on board is only 128 MB, but the device has a built-in flash 8 GB drive, in which you can install programs, store cards to work with navigation, etc.</p>

<p style="text-align: justify;">The novelty is equipped with 3.2-inch display with HVGA resolution (320 x 480 pixels), established in AMOLED-technology. This is a very bright display with live (literally) images and natural color. Granularity is not visible on the display, and viewing angles can be described as the highest. Unfortunately the display fades in the sun so that reading at least some information is not possible. In general we can say that this is one of the most suitable displays for viewing mobile video and photo.</p>

<p style="text-align: justify;">Media uses Sony PSP interface which is both intuitive and cool looking. The app handles photos, video and music. The FM radio with RDS has a good reception. The FM radio app can save favorite channels and play the radio in the background.  K850i has Sony Ericsson&#8217;s free TrackID service that identifies songs playing on the radio or in the environment, and this feature works quite well (it requires a data connection since the track info is downloaded over the Internet using the phone&#8217;s browser).<br />
The phone supports a wide variety of audio formats including MP3, Podcasts, Audiobooks, MP4, AAC, RealAudio (.ra, .rm), WMA, XMF, M4A, WAV and midi. Video formats include MPEG4 (MP4 with AAC or AMR audio), 3GPP, WMV (.asf, .wmv) and RealVideo 8 (.rv, .rm). The K850i supports OMA DRM 1.0 and 2.0 for copy protected music, video and Java applications.</p>

<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Camera</strong><br />
Obviously, the 5 megapixel camera with an autofocus lens and Xenon flash is the centerpiece of the Cybershot K850i. And it didn&#8217;t disappoint us, in fact for the first release firmware, the camera was stable, and overall did an excellent job of imaging. The SE isn&#8217;t as fast as a dedicated digital camera, but it&#8217;s quite usable and you just might manage to catch a fleeting moment.<br />
K850i can shoot photos at a maximum 2592 x 1944 resolution in 5MP mode and has a variety of lesser resolutions from 3MP down to VGA. The camera can shoot video at QVGA resolution (320 x 240) at 30 fps. The phone has a hardware slider button that you&#8217;ll use to select photo, video or playback mode. There&#8217;s a tiny camera application launcher button that turns the camera on and off as well as controlling the lens cover. When the camera app is running the entire screen becomes a viewfinder and it runs in landscape orientation.<br />
Photo quality is excellent, with more usable data than K790i and K800i&#8217;s 3MP images and better exposure (no white haze or washed out effect which we sometimes noticed with K800i). Colors are accurate, if not sometimes understated and we couldn&#8217;t find a hint of color cast in outdoor shots. Indoor shots became overly warm as the camera didn&#8217;t compensate well enough for incandescent lighting in auto exposure mode with the flash on (turning off the flash fixed the problem). Indoor evening shots in poor light were pleasing with good blacks, but surprisingly the N95 managed a more exposed shot.</p>

The K850i&#8217;s Xenon flash illuminates close subjects very well, but doesn&#8217;t add much ambient lighting, which means your subject will be decently exposed but awash in a sea of near blackness. For all but dark club shots and outdoor night shots, we recommend experimenting with turning the flash off &#8211; we consistently got brighter and more balanced shots while it was off. The camera uses a LED (actually 3 tiny LEDs) to illuminate the scene for focus and fires the power-hungry Xenon flash only when snapping the photo.<br />
Should K790i owners upgrade it, based on the higher resolution camera? That depends on what you do with your photos: 3MP is really good enough for viewing on the average monitor (if you&#8217;ve got a 30&#8243; LCD display, that&#8217;s a different story), and you won&#8217;t be able to view a 3MP image at 100%, let alone a 5MP image. But if you want to print photos, the extra pixels and sharper images are worth it. From what we can tell, the lens quality hasn&#8217;t improved.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-1127" title="8" src="http://www.newphonesreviews.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/09/86.jpg" alt="8" width="450" height="366" /><br />
The camera has a wealth of manual settings for ISO, white balance, flash control, auto/infinity focus, metering mode and 7 scene modes. Sony Ericsson&#8217;s BestPic feature shoots several shots with varied settings so you can choose the best one, and Photo fix lets you tweak photos you&#8217;ve taken before transferring them to a PC. The camera has 16x digital zoom, but alas no optical zoom (that&#8217;s still a rarity on camera phones). Video quality is very good with no jerkiness or blockiness. Colors are strong and accurate, even in low light, and the sound is clear.</p>

<p style="text-align: justify; ">The new mackintosh is positioned just as secure (certified IP54), and not as water-shock-mud-resistant phone. This means that you shouldn’t swim with it, dive in the bathtub, put it under the wheels of a car, checking the strength of the shell, or crack the nuts, in order to withdraw the edible core. The tube is designed for active users &#8211; bikers, skiers, snowboarders, tourists and other fidgets. If the owner falls from a great height, the shell tube should not be greatly affected, and in successful set of circumstances there will be no trace of the fall to the ground. I admit that a couple of times I did throw the device a stone road at a speed of 15-20 km/h, and… there was only a small dent left on the body. My colleagues did not take long to be persuaded, and they were happy to be included in the experiment, heartily dropping  and throwing and the device on the floor, but the result was just a kick back of the lid along with the battery, which is just what should happen in such a situation.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ify; ">In addition, I watered the B2700 by a watering-can, and to cap the water procedures dipped it for a minute in a mug with water. And nothing, it survived. By the way, the manufacturer states that with this innovation one could be caught in the rain without any consequences for the electronic filling. And more on water and Samsung &#8211; as the phone has two openings for the speakers and a microphone, the infiltration of water (in case of dipping, of course) inside – is a matter of time.</p>
